The Problem with Selling Bicycles on National Platforms#
When trying to sell a used cycle online, many people turn to massive nationwide e-commerce or classified sites. However, selling a physical, bulky item like a bicycle on these platforms introduces major headaches:
- Shipping is almost impossible: You cannot easily pack a fully assembled bicycle into a cardboard box. Disassembling the frame, wheels, and handlebars takes tools and effort, and courier fees for heavy items can wipe out your profit.
- Platform commissions: Many resale websites take a significant percentage of your final sale price just for hosting your listing.
- Fake buyers and scams: Dealing with out-of-town buyers increases the risk of payment fraud and time-wasters.

4 Tips to Get Maximum Resale Value for Your Used Cycle#
To attract serious buyers quickly and get the price you want, optimize your listing with these quick steps:
- Clean and lube it: A rusty, dusty bike looks cheap. Wash the frame, wipe the seat, pump air into the tires, and add a little oil to the chain. A clean, smooth-riding bicycle usually commands a better price.
- Highlight important specs: Clearly state the brand, wheel size, whether it has gears, the brake type, and for kids' cycles, the ideal age group.
- Be honest about wear and tear: If it needs new brake pads or has a torn seat cover, mention it clearly. Honest listings build immediate trust.
- Take outdoor photos: Use bright daylight and capture the full side profile, the chain or gears, and the tire tread to show the cycle's condition.
Safe Handover Tips for Local Cycle Sales#
Before meeting the buyer, make sure the tires have air and the brakes are working well enough for a short test ride. It also helps to meet during daylight hours in an apartment compound, community park, or another well-lit public area.

3 Items1How much should I price my used kids' cycle?
Pricing depends on the brand, condition, and age of the cycle. Generally, a kids' cycle in good condition that is 1 to 3 years old can sell for about 40% to 60% of its original retail price.
2Should I repair flat tires before selling?
Yes, it is highly recommended. A buyer cannot properly test ride a cycle with flat tires. Spending a small amount to fix the tubes can help you sell faster and at a better price.
